On behalf of the entire membership of the Topeka Technology Leadership Forum and the Kansas City IT Leadership Forum we are honored to thank you for your participation as an attendee or sponsor in our 7th Annual Kansas City IT Symposium. As the host and driving force behind this unique conference, we are confident you will find your experience to be beneficial through the information you receive and the relationships you generate.The goal of the Symposium is to create an environment conducive to peer networking amongst IT Executives, their respective management teams and a select few vendors. This is achieved through providing peer-driven content addressing the relevant topics of today’s IT leaders. The ability to receive information on opportunities and challenges facing all of us and capture actionable information from peers that you can apply to your own challenges, make attending this event rewarding and productive.

The Kansas City IT Symposium is recognized as the leading event in the state for IT leaders. Our 2006 event attracted over 100 executives from 50 of the regions top IT organizations. The Symposium is a by invitation only event and pre registration is required. Once registered, your information will be reviewed to confirm your status as an IT professional. This is performed in an effort to ensure only qualified IT professionals attend the Symposium.

About the Forums
Established 7 years and 9 years ago respectfully, the Kansas City IT Leadership Forum and Topeka Technology Leadership Forum were created by leading Executives from many of regions largest organizations. Since their inception, the Forums have grown in membership and value per member. The 55 Forum member companies meet monthly to share information in a confidential, comfortable and productive environment.
